Transaction 5c58bedfab66575c5a46e24eb205bfb2af36b26b236f5ed36c0f2d32553dbe76
1 Input
1 Output
-
5c58bedfab66575c5a46e24eb205bfb2af36b26b236f5ed36c0f2d32553dbe76:0
- value
- 299307
- script pubkey
- OP_0 OP_PUSHBYTES_20 54955b7c80a4c0e88149a6059387275396147b2c
- address
- bc1q2j24klyq5nqw3q2f5cze8pe82wtpg7evsarfrz